1. Black + Decker 12-Cup Coffeemaker

The Black + Decker is an excellent option if you’re on a budget and still need something of value. This model does not compromise any features and will keep your coffee piping hot for hours.

The coffee maker has an Everstream showerhead that evenly extracts flavor from the coffee grounds. It is a feature that’s similar to coffee brewing using the pour-over method. Plus, it has a small batch brew option if you’re brewing smaller quantities.

If you feel making coffee in the morning takes much time, the Black + Decker may be your convenient alternative. All you need is to set the brewing time and wait until the magic happens. The LCD is easy to use and shows the brewing time, how long since your last brew, etc.

2. Keurig K-Duo Plus Coffee Maker

The Keurig thermal carafe coffee maker is an excellent upgrade from its first release, and Keurig fans will love this one. It doubles up as a single-serve pot machine and a thermal carafe allowing you to use coffee pods or ground coffee.

Like most coffee makers in this list, it is easy to operate, and you’ll only press one button before the machine does its magic. Plus, the Smart start feature ensures you don’t have to wait for the water to be hot for it to start brewing.

Keep in mind you can brew 6, 8, 10, or 12 cups inside the machine or make a single cup for a punchy brew. The coffee maker’s ergonomic design makes it easy to maintain and clean.

It has plenty of programmable features. For instance, Keurig only uses the exact amount of water for a brew, so you don’t need to refill after every use.

3. Hamilton Beach Programmable Front-Fill Coffee Maker

The Hamilton Beach Coffee Maker is undeniably a great choice for coffee lovers. It is easy to use, brews with precision, and the thermal carafe keeps your coffee hot for long.

Perhaps one notable feature of this machine is its brewing flexibility. The iced settings allow you to brew cold or hot coffee, and remains fresh for hours. And you can make it the way you want it.

The Hamilton Beach coffee maker has a specific design with a container built inside to hold the coffee. This means you don’t have the chunky pot used to store coffee. So, you can make coffee in your mug, pot, or travel container. The coffee stays in the container fresh and hot for up to 4 hours.

The only downside to this piece would be the use of paper filters which is a must. Plus, it doesn’t have a grinder, so you can’t use coffee pods or capsules.

6. OXO Brew 8 Cup Coffee Maker

OXO is known for minimalistic designs, particularly in coffee machines. This model is no different and comes in a sleek pour-over design with only four buttons.

But don’t be fooled by its minimalism OXO Brew 8 Cup Coffee Maker churns out fantastic coffee within a few minutes.

It has a rainmaker showerhead designed to evenly distribute water as it brews, maintaining a rich flavor and consistency. You can brew two ways; using a single cup or with the thermal carafe that holds up to 8 cups.

For single-cup users, the machine has an adjustable mug stand, so you don’t have spills when your coffee cup is too small.

How to Choose the Best Thermal Carafe Coffee Maker

Before picking out the best coffee grinder with a thermal carafe, you should know a couple of things.

Settings

First, you want to check if the coffee machine has customizable settings and allows you to automate grinding or brewing.

Capacity

The coffee capacity is crucial as it dictates how much coffee you can brew at a go. The biggest thermal carafes hold up to 12 cups, while the smallest can do a maximum of 8 cups.

Brewing Time and Temperature

Also, brewing time and temperature should be on your checklist. You need to know if your coffee is brewed for five minutes or 30 minutes.

If you need coffee to carry or travel with, consider the thermal carafe option- it keeps your coffee piping hot for hours.

FAQs About Thermal Carafe Coffee Maker

Does thermal carafe keep coffee hot?

A thermal carafe is made of a double aluminum layer to maintain temperatures inside. It can keep coffee hot for a few hours.

How long does coffee stay hot in stainless steel carafe?

Stainless steel carafe is effective at keeping coffee hot, and can do so for up to 2 hours.

How do you keep coffee warm for hours?

You can use thermos to keep your coffee warm as they are vacuum-insulated and can maintain the temperature for more than 12 hours.

Are thermal carafe coffee maker better than glass?

Apart from being unbreakable, thermal carafes are better at keeping coffee hot than glass. They are low maintenance and will last longer than glass carafes.
